There's some good news on the injury front for Chelsea fans today, as a promising Chelsea youngster on loan has returned to first team training, after being stretchered off the pitch in his last match. Marco Van Ginkel looked to be somewhat seriously injured the last time we got to see him, but returned to the pitch this afternoon, according to AC Milan's official site.
Van Ginkel was injured in his first AC Milan appearance, a start against Empoli on September 23 which eventually ended as a 2-2 draw. He was also an unused sub in the 1-0 loss to Juventus, as well as a 5-4 victory over Parma.
While Marco trained today, I doubt he'll jump right back into the starting eleven after a several week injury layoff. More likely, Van Ginkel will find himself on the Milan bench when they face Hellas Verona this Sunday. Hopefully it will be a short stay on the bench, and he'll be starting matches again soon.
